Fahad Al-Rashidi (Arabic: فهد الرشيدي; born 16 May 1997) is a Saudi Arabian professional footballer who plays as a winger for the Saudi Arabia national team and the for the Saudi Pro League side Al-Ahli.[1][2]

Club career

Al-Rashidi started his career at the youth team of Al-Selmiyah before joining the youth team of Al-Hilal on 2 July 2015.[3] He was promoted to the first team during the 2017–18 season and made his first-team debut 27 July 2017 against Iraqi side Naft Al-Wasat in the 2017 Arab Club Championship group stage match.[4] On 30 January 2018, Al-Rashidi made his league debut for Al-Hilal against Al-Raed.[5] On 19 January 2019, Al-Rashidi joined Ohod on a six-month loan.[6] On 17 August 2019, Al-Rashidi joined Al-Taawoun on a free transfer.[7]

On 1 January 2023, Al-Rashidi signed a pre-contract agreement with Al-Ahli.[8] He officially joined the club following the conclusion of the 2022–23 season.
